The MMA will host a webinar on Dec. 9 spotlighting three “alternative response teams” throughout the state.
These unarmed community response programs, rooted in racial equity and trauma-informed practices, work to provide behavioral health support and resources to community members.
Attendees will hear about Lynn’s CALM Team, Cambridge’s Community Assistance Response and Engagement (CARE) Team, and Amherst’s Community Responders for Equity, Safety and Service (CRESS) team.
Panelists will include:
• CRESS Director Camille Theriaque
• Cambridge Community Safety Department Director Marie Mathieu
• Lynn Calm Team Program Administrator Abdel Razak Kawaf
• Lynn Diversity, Equity and Inclusion Officer Faustina Cuevas
Presenters will give an overview of how each initiative operates, and how they differ in scope, funding, and staffing based on the community’s needs and resources. They will also discuss the importance of community buy-in when launching a similar program.

This webinar will review the legal landscape regarding the sale of kratom, an unregulated plant-based substance commonly sold and used for its psychological and physiological effects. Attendees will learn about the power municipalities have to regulate kratom, and hear from local public health officials with firsthand experience. Free for MEHA members, $25 for non-members.

MEPHC is hosting a Youth Mental Health First Aid course.
Why Take Youth Mental Health First Aid?
This course gives public health professionals practical tools to recognize and respond to mental health and substance use challenges in young people (ages 12–18). You’ll learn how to spot early warning signs, offer supportive, appropriate first-line help, and connect youth to the right resources—skills that directly strengthen community outreach, crisis response, and prevention efforts.

Emily Whittaker-Smith from CMRPC Training Hub presents on recreational camps. Topics include emergency preparedness plans, requirements amongst different camps, staff qualifications and training requirements, camp program binders, and application of 105 CMR 430.000 for reviews and inspections.
